Neighborhood Overview

Remnant Christian School is situated in a quiet, accessible sector of Madera, a city known for its agricultural roots and central San Joaquin Valley location. The venue is easily reachable via major regional arteries including State Route 99, which serves as the primary north-south corridor for the area. Most visitors arriving by air will utilize Fresno Yosemite International Airport, located approximately 25 miles to the south, requiring a drive of about 30 to 40 minutes under typical traffic conditions. Parking at the facility is generally straightforward, though it is advisable to arrive early during peak school event days to ensure convenient access to designated zones.

The surrounding neighborhood is primarily suburban and light industrial, offering a calm environment for school-related gatherings. While public transit is limited, the area is very conducive to personal vehicles and rideshare services, which are widely available in the Madera region. We recommend coordinating group arrivals if you are traveling with a team to minimize congestion in the parking lot. By planning your route ahead of time and accounting for potential school-zone traffic, you can ensure a stress-free arrival. Always check local traffic reports before your commute, especially during weekday morning and afternoon hours when school traffic is highest.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ters in Madera are cool and can be foggy, with temperatures frequently dropping into the low 40s at night. Visitors should pack layers, including a warm jacket for outdoor movement between buildings. While snow is extremely rare, you may encounter damp conditions that require comfortable, water-resistant footwear for walking across the school grounds.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ring offers beautiful weather with mild temperatures and blooming landscapes, making it an ideal time for school activities. You will likely enjoy temperatures in the 70s, perfect for light clothing during the day. As summer approaches, the heat begins to climb, so remember to pack sunscreen and hats for any outdoor events.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er brings significant heat, with daytime temperatures often exceeding 95 degrees. It is critical to stay hydrated and seek shade whenever possible during outdoor sessions. Lightweight, breathable clothing is essential, and most events will likely move indoors to avoid the intense midday sun. Plan your schedule to minimize exposure during the hottest afternoon hours.

🍂

Fall season

Fall is a delightful time to visit, as the intense summer heat fades into pleasant, cool evenings. You will experience crisp mornings and warm, sunny afternoons that are perfect for outdoor gatherings. Light layers are recommended, as the temperature can fluctuate significantly from the start of the day to the evening. It is a very comfortable season for travel.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is primarily concentrated in the winter months, typically arriving in short, manageable bursts. While snow is essentially non-existent in the city, the rain can make parking lots slick and increase travel times slightly. Always keep an umbrella handy and check local forecasts before your trip to ensure you are prepared for damp, cool days.
